Uploaded image for project: 'Bedrock Dedicated Server'
  1. Bedrock Dedicated Server
  2. BDS-17722

Pre-rendered chunks not fully loading in world.

XMLWordPrintable

    • Icon: Bug Bug
    • Resolution: Duplicate
    • None
    • 1.19.31 Hotfix
    • None
    • Unconfirmed

      Since 1.19.30 (and still in 1.19.31 Hotfix) I've been seeing a severe performance degradation where chunks do not fully load and remain as empty spaces in the world.  It can take upto a minute for these areas to fully load, sometimes I need to leave the area and return for it to correctly load.  While the chunks are incomplete, the player is also unable to enter that area and is blocked as if hitting an invisible wall.

      I've also noticed this performance degradation when exploring and moving around the world too (specifically when using an Elytra) where the player will just stop moving in the world & be prevented from going further.  This worsens the more the player explores or moves around the world through unloaded chunks.

      This is more apparent when logging into the server, as the world can take a long time to load.

      Checking the server load, performance and IO/Network throughput, while these chunks are unloaded, there is very little load on the host and no IO or Network bottlenecks.

      My BDS Server stores all world data on a remote NFS Share, however I have moved the world data to local storage to rule out any networking issues, and this made no difference at all.

      There are no corruption warnings in the terminal output, and the only log entries are the standard player joined/left and auto compaction messages.

      Performance degradation is also the same regardless of platform used to play (PC/Switch/PS4).  Performance on pre-1.19.30 server is absolutely fine.

            Unassigned Unassigned
            ErTnEc Paul Bramhall
            Votes:
            0 Vote for this issue
            Watchers:
            1 Start watching this issue

              Created:
              Updated:
              Resolved: